- If you're looking for a lightweight and easy-to-use Apache dashboard plugin, you might consider using GoAccess. It's a real-time web log analyzer that provides detailed statistics about your website's traffic. GoAccess offers a command-line interface and a web-based dashboard, making it convenient to monitor your website's performance. While it may not have all the advanced features of other plugins, it can still provide valuable insights into your website's traffic patterns and help you optimize your website for better performance.
